A Resurrection to Immortality: The Resurrection, Our Only Hope of Life After DeathWestBow Press, 14/04/2011 - 612 من الصفحات Life is the most important possession we have. Without it, there is nothing. Only by the resurrection at the second coming of Christ will anyone have life after death.
